Blackburn boss Mark Hughes was full of praise for his central strike partnership of Roque Santa Cruz and Benni McCarthy, both of whom scored in the 4-2 home defeat of Reading.
"Their quicker, bigger and stronger than I ever was. Yeah, their not bad!
"They are good players. Some of their play today was excellent.
"Technically they are very proficient football players. They are comfortable on the ball, can link up play, be creative in the final third and bring other players into the game."
